SA State Corruption Fighting Bodies

SA State Corruption Fighting Bodies
National Priority Crime Operational Committee (NPCOC)
The NPCOC coordinates the response of law enforcement institutions to priority crimes including corruption.
South African Police Service (SAPS)
The SAPS investigates petty corruption.
Located within SAPS:
Directorate for Priority Crime Investigation (‘Hawks’)
The Hawks investigate serious corruption.
Crime Intelligence
Crime Intelligence collects information on crime patterns to support investigations.

National Prosecuting Authority
The NPA is the only institution in the country that can prosecute corruption. Located within NPA: 

Special Investigating Unit
The SIU recovers money lost by the state due to corruption.
Financial Intelligence Centre (FIC)
The FIC identifies the proceeds of corruption.
Independent Police Investigative Directorate (IPID)
The IPID investigates claims of corruption against the SAPS
State Security Agency (SSA)
The SSA collects intelligence about corruption.

Institutions with a supporting role in anti-corruption.

South African Revenue Service (SARS)
SARS assists other agencies in investigating and prosecuting corruption.
Auditor General of South Africa (AGSA)
The AGSA audits public institutions.
Public Protector
The PP investigates maladministration in public institutions and prescribes remedies.
Public Service Commission (PSC)
The PSC promotes integrity in public institutions.
Public Administration, Ethics Integrity and Disciplinary Technical Assistance Unit
The TAU promotes ethics in government and conducts consequence management.
Companies and Intellectual Property Commission (CIPC)
The CPIC administers information about companies.
Financial Sector Conduct Authority (FSCA)
The FSCA regulates the financial sector.
